Weddings can be a source of joy, but also a breeding ground for drama. One couple had planned a large country wedding, but when only 14 guests RSVP’d, they decided to switch things up and treat their small guest list to an all-expenses-paid trip to Hawaii. However, the bride’s sister, who had initially declined the wedding invite, is now fuming that she wasn’t reinvited to the tropical paradise.

The bride and groom’s decision to switch their wedding to an all-expenses-paid trip to Hawaii has left the bride’s sister feeling left out and angry. Despite initially declining the wedding invite due to work and travel concerns, the sister now believes she should have been reinvited to the tropical paradise. The couple, however, is faced with budget constraints and the potential of downgrading the trip for everyone else. Is the sister’s anger justified, or is the couple right to stick to their plans?
